Beurer BM 44 Blood Pressure Monitor Specification

The Beurer BM 44 Blood Pressure Monitor is a compact and user-friendly device designed for accurate and efficient blood pressure monitoring at home. It features a fully automatic operation which simplifies the measurement process, making it accessible even for individuals with minimal technical expertise. The device is equipped with a large, easy-to-read LCD display that clearly presents systolic and diastolic pressures along with pulse rate, ensuring users can easily interpret their results. The monitor employs a one-button operation system, enhancing user convenience and reducing the potential for operational errors.

The BM 44 is designed with an ergonomic cuff that fits upper arm circumferences ranging from 22 to 30 centimeters, providing comfort and accuracy across a wide range of body types. It incorporates a risk indicator, which classifies readings based on the guidelines of the World Health Organization (WHO), allowing users to understand their blood pressure status at a glance. Additionally, the device includes an error message function to alert users of any operational issues, such as incorrect cuff placement or movement during measurement, ensuring reliability and precision.

Powered by four AAA batteries, the Beurer BM 44 is portable and suitable for travel. It features an auto-off function, preserving battery life when not in use. Although it does not support data memory function, the simplicity and effectiveness of the BM 44 make it an ideal choice for individuals seeking straightforward blood pressure monitoring without the need for advanced features. Its design and functionality reflect Beurer's commitment to providing quality health monitoring solutions that are both accessible and accurate.

Beurer BM 44 Blood Pressure Monitor F.A.Q.

How do I correctly position the cuff when using the Beurer BM 44 Blood Pressure Monitor?

To position the cuff correctly, wrap it around your upper arm approximately 2-3 cm above the elbow joint. Ensure that the cuff is level with your heart and that the tubing is aligned with the center of your arm.

What should I do if the Beurer BM 44 displays an error message?

If an error message appears, refer to the user manual for specific error codes. Common solutions include repositioning the cuff, ensuring the monitor is at heart level, and checking for any obstructions in the air tube.

How can I ensure accurate readings with the Beurer BM 44?

To ensure accurate readings, sit quietly for 5 minutes before measurement, keep your feet flat on the floor, and avoid talking during the measurement. Additionally, measure at the same time each day for consistency.

How often should I calibrate my Beurer BM 44 Blood Pressure Monitor?

The Beurer BM 44 does not require regular calibration. However, it is advisable to have it checked every 2 years or if you suspect inaccurate readings.

What is the correct way to store the Beurer BM 44?

Store the Beurer BM 44 in a cool, dry place away from direct sunlight. Remove the batteries if the device will not be used for an extended period to prevent battery leakage.

Can I use rechargeable batteries in the Beurer BM 44?

Yes, you can use rechargeable batteries in the Beurer BM 44. Ensure they are fully charged and suitable for the device's power requirements.

Why is the monitor not turning on when I press the button?

First, check if the batteries are correctly installed and have sufficient charge. If the problem persists, replace the batteries with new ones.

How do I clean the cuff of the Beurer BM 44?

To clean the cuff, use a damp cloth with mild soap. Do not submerge it in water or use harsh chemicals. Allow it to air dry completely before use.

How can I interpret the readings on the Beurer BM 44?

The Beurer BM 44 displays systolic and diastolic pressure along with pulse rate. Compare the readings to the blood pressure categories provided in the user manual to determine if your readings are within a normal range.

What should I do if the readings seem inconsistent?

If readings are inconsistent, ensure the cuff is properly positioned and the monitor is at heart level. Take multiple readings over a period of time to identify any patterns. If inconsistencies persist, consult with a healthcare professional.
